How do I reference a source cited by another author in the …

WebMar 1, 2024 · In the reference list, provide the details of the work in which you found the quotation or idea (this work is considered the secondary source). For the in-text citation, include the author and year of both the original and secondary sources. Add "as cited in" between the sources in the in-text citation. WebAug 19, 2024 · A secondary source is a source cited within another source. Sometimes, this is called an indirect source. However, if this is not … WebApr 15, 2024 · Citing a quote in APA Style. To cite a direct quote in APA, you must include the author’s last name, the year, and a page number, all separated by commas. If the quote appears on a single page, use “p.”; if it spans a page range, use “pp.”. An APA in-text citation can be parenthetical or narrative.

WebMar 27, 2024 · When there are two authors, simply cite both surnames, separated by “and”. When there are three or more authors, cite the first author’s surname followed by “et al.” if the citation appears in parentheses. If you cite in the main text, instead of “et al.”, write “and colleagues” or “and others”. Number of authors.
